Express heartfelt sympathy with the My Admiration Wreath from Aldgate Flowers. This elegant circular tribute features a lush base of white chrysanthemums, carefully arranged to symbolise purity, remembrance and the circle of life. Handcrafted by our expert florists in Aldgate, it is beautifully accented with striking blue sprayed roses, creating a serene and dignified display of beauty, honour and sincerity.

Perfect as a funeral wreath or condolence tribute, this design is available in three sizes to suit your needs: Original (30cm / 12"), Deluxe (36cm / 14") and Grand (41cm / 16"), with the Deluxe size shown. Each wreath is made fresh to order using premium flowers, ensuring a long-lasting and respectful arrangement for the service.

We deliver across Aldgate and surrounding London areas with reliable, fast delivery, so your sympathy flowers arrive on time and in perfect condition. Some blooms may arrive with their natural guard petals to protect the inner petals in transit; simply remove these outer petals before display. Due to seasonal availability, substitutions of equal or superior quality may be made, while maintaining the overall style and colour palette.
